Early Life
Daniel Brühl was born on June 16, 1978, in Barcelona, Spain. His father, Hanno Brühl, was a German TV director born in São Paulo, Brazil, and his mother was a teacher from Spain. This Spanish-German actor became interested in acting at a young age and pursued it as a career.
Career
Brühl started his acting career in 1995, working in a German soap opera called Forbidden Love. However, his breakthrough role came in 2003 with the film Good Bye, Lenin!, which earned him critical acclaim and various awards. He gained further recognition when he starred as “Frederik Zoller” in Quentin Tarantino’s Inglourious Basterds.
Brühl’s talent and versatility in portraying different characters allowed him to work in international productions like The Bourne Ultimatum, The Fifth Estate, and A Most Wanted Man. One of his notable roles was playing former Formula 1 driver Niki Lauda in Ron Howard’s Rush, for which he received widespread acclaim and award nominations.
